Childcare, Education & Safeguarding
- Have an awareness of Child Protection, Safeguarding and being able to report any concerns
- Recognise each child as an individual, understanding their development, recording and observing their progress
- Be actively involved in the planning process and proposing suitable activities that motivate children’s learning and development based on their interests
- Supervising children at all times
- Help ensure that all children attending the nursery setting are kept safe and that their health and wellbeing is considered at all times
- Assist in the provision of an appealing, safe, creative and stimulating environment
- Have an understanding of the policies and procedures for assisting with meals and snacks for the children, including those with special diets and allergies
- Be a responsible, reliable and effective member of staff working flexibly as part of the team
- Communicate clearly and effectively with parents/guardians with regard to their child’s day and development
- Assist in the care and cleaning of all toys and equipment within the nursery
- Ensure all company forms are filled out correctly
- Be familiar with and work within all company policies and procedures
- Take responsibility for your own personal awareness of all emergency and security procedures, drop off and collection policies
- Work to all legislative standards and guidelines, developing an understanding of Development Matters.
- Uphold Hopscotch’s high standards of cleanliness and hygiene in all areas of the nursery paying particular attention to the nappy changing, food service and sleep areas
- Ensure the highest levels of your own personal hygiene
- Ensure all company policies are adhered to and report any breach in procedure
- Attend all staff meetings as required
- Practitioners will be part of regular supervision meetings
- Participate in the company’s appraisal scheme establishing and working to a Personal Development Plan
- Participate in all internal and external training/coaching courses as and when identified
- Practitioners must undergo a DBS Enhanced check and we will require all staff to sign up for the DBS Update Service
- Participate in the company mentoring scheme
- Cover staff lunches where needed
- Assist with all nursery activities as and when required
